Sealing

Window seals, also referred to as upvc window repairs window seals, play an an important role in the insulation of double-glazed windows. Faulty seals may cause condensation, drafts and other issues. Fortunately damaged seals can be repaired or replaced to restore your double glazing's efficiency.

The leakage of water between glass panes is the most common sign of double-glazed windows which need to be sealed. This water can cause damage to the window frames and raise energy bills. Moisture between the glass can cause a hazy appearance that may fluctuate in accordance with the temperature of the outdoor or indoor humidity levels.

It is recommended to contact the installer who installed your double-glazed windows if you believe that your window seals aren't working properly. They can visit your home and repair any damaged areas, which is often cheaper than replacing the entire window unit. Also, you should check your warranty paperwork because the company who installed your double-glazed windows might still be covered under warranty, which will save you money on the cost of repairs or replacements.

A double glazed window repair technician will employ various tools to fix your windows that have broken, such as gasket rollers that assist in helping to push the new seals into place. These tools make it easier to get an airtight seal which is essential for the functionality of your windows.

If the seal between double-glazed window's glass panes becomes damaged, it can lead to a number of issues, including condensation between the panes, the inefficiency of the energy, and a distorted view. A replacement of the window seal will usually involve taking the glass off and replacing it with a new one, which can be done in most cases without having to replace the entire frame of the window.

It is recommended to hire an expert to repair or replace the double-glazed window seals. It's typically more time-consuming and laborious than doing it yourself. It is also recommended to employ an expert company for repair of double glazing that is certified and registered. This will give you peace of mind knowing they will complete the job correctly.

Glass

Double-glazed windows are composed of two panes with an airspace between them. The air is filled with gases such as argon and krypton which slow down the heat transfer through your windows. This helps to keep your home at a pleasant temperature without overworking your heating and cooling system. It is essential to repair your double-glazed window as quickly when it starts to crack or broken.

Typically replacing the glass in your double glazed window is the most effective solution to fix it. However, it's important to understand that fixing a double-paned windows is more than just replacing the glass. It also involves making repairs to the factory seal in order to ensure that your window functions exactly as it should. This is why it's better to call in an expert for double glazing repairs instead of trying to fix it yourself.

Double glazing can last for years with proper maintenance, but there are issues that can develop. It's not uncommon for these issues to decrease the effectiveness of your double glazed windows and doors, as well as make them look unattractive. There are a variety of solutions to these issues at a reasonable price. There is no need to replace your windows.

A common problem that many double glazed windows suffer from is misting. This occurs when the seal around the glass panel fails and moisture-laden air can get between the glass panes. This can cause windows to become cloudy, or even wet. This also reduces the insulation of double-glazed windows.

This type of problem is extremely frustrating since it can seriously impact the appearance and performance of your double-glazed windows. To avoid this issue it is important to call the company from which you purchased your double-glazed windows as soon as possible to report the issue. It is crucial to write it down by phone or email. This will provide you with an account of the discussion and any agreements you reach, as well as when the problem will be addressed.

Frames

If the frame of your double glazing is damaged, it's going to need to be repaired. It could be caused by various causes, such as wear and tear over time, or extreme weather conditions. In the majority of cases, frames can be repaired. However, in some circumstances, they may have to completely be replaced.

It's crucial to act fast if you have any problems with double-glazed windows. This will avoid further damage and keep your home safe and warm. You can also cut down on your energy bills by ensuring that your windows are as effective as they can be.

Double glazing owners often complain that their doors and windows are difficult to open. This could be due to various reasons, such as extreme temperatures or the accumulation of dirt. In most instances, the issue can be solved by a professional double glazing repair service.

Another issue that is common is misting between the panes of glass. The seals are often to blame for misting. These can be fixed by repairing the double glazing however, they might require replacement completely. This will help to reduce condensation and prevent draughts from forming.

Many people have reported that their double glazing has gotten saggy or dropped. This could be due a variety of factors such as extreme weather conditions or damage caused by falling objects. It is recommended to contact the installer as soon as possible if you notice any issues.

Double glazing is an excellent investment for your home, and it's crucial to fix any issues promptly. This will help you save money on your energy bills, and make sure that your double-glazed windows are operating as efficiently as possible.

Hardware

When it comes to double glazed windows, there is many different problems that could develop in time. These can include issues with seals, water intrusion and foggy glass. Many people believe that they need to replace their entire window when these issues arise. However, most of them can be repaired.

To fix a double glazed window the first step is to remove the existing pane from the frame. To prevent further damage to the glass, you should take care when removing the old pane. The next step is to take any paint or sealants from the edges of the glass. You can use a putty blade or scraper to get rid of the sealant. After the old pane is removed, the new pane can be inserted into the frame, and a new layer of sealant applied.

If the window is under warranty, it may be possible to get the manufacturer to replace the glass unit free. If not, it's recommended to hire a professional to examine the window and make any necessary repairs.

The hardware is equally important as the glass in a double-glazed window repairs near me. The sash and balance are used to open and shut the window. These parts can cause issues with the window, and can even pose a safety risk. For double glazing repair, contact a specialist if the sash and balance are damaged.

Condensation between panes is another common problem with double-glazed windows. This is caused by warm air getting in contact with the cooler window panes. This is a natural phenomenon, but it can cause water to enter and cause the rotting process to begin. To avoid this it is essential to install a suitable ventilation system within your home.

It is crucial to locate a double-glazing firm that has experience working with historic buildings if you own an historic listed building. In many cases, it's possible to fit slim profile double-glazed units into listed structures without compromising the style of the property. These options can be constructed to look similar to the windows of the past and will keep the home warm and retain its original charm.
